摘 要:针对提高抽油机系统效率的问题,结合我国抽油机的使用现状,首先对抽油机运行过程中系统效率的影响因素进行深入分析,在此基础上,提出提高抽油机系统效率的措施,为提高油田的生产效率奠定基础。研究表明:电动机损失功率、参数配置不合理、工作人员操作水平低以及设备腐蚀是影响抽油机系统效率的四大因素,因此,相关企业需要从确定合理的工作制度、提高电动机的系统效率、提高井下抽油泵的运行效率、提高抽油机管理标准、加强设备防腐以及加强工作人员培训六方面入手,采取多项有效措施,全面提高油田的生产效率。Aiming at the problem of improving the efficiency of the pumping unit system,this study combines the current status of the use of pumping units in China.First of all,an in-depth analysis of the influencing factors of the system efficiency during the operation of the pumping unit is carried out.Technical measures for the efficiency of engine systems lay the foundation for improving the production efficiency of oil fields.Studies have shown that motor loss of power,irrational parameter configuration,low operating level of staff and equipment corrosion are the four major factors that affect the efficiency of pumping unit systems.Therefore,relevant companies need to determine a reasonable working system,improve the motor system efficiency,Starting from the six aspects of improving the operating efficiency of downhole pumps,improving the management standards of pumping units,strengthening the equipment's anticorrosion,and strengthening staff training,a number of effective measures have been taken to comprehensively improve the production efficiency of oil fields.
